Arioso is a friendly, quiet coffee-, furniture- and flower shop very close to Deák Ferenc Square. It’s a small, welcoming place where you can sit down in the middle of the day for a tea and a hot sandwich, or maybe a salad, and have some peace away from the rush and crush of the street. If you want to get even farther away from the noise, check out the mellow garden in the backyard, surrounded by the gangways of an old residential house turned into a language school. There are no hard opening times for the garden, it's available whenever the weather is nice.
They also have furniture and other home decoration elements like candelabras for sale, and if you walk a few meters down the street, you’ll find the Arioso flower shop (which is where the photo was taken) with a wide selection of really elegant potted and vase plants, bouquets and the like.

I always go for the rose and caramel teas, which I usually accompany with a few biscuits dipped into the melted sweetness.
